BURNETT UNIT 9 (API 36532228) is operated by R. LACY SERVICES, LTD. and sits in the BRIGGS (UPPER TRAVIS PEAK) oil & gas field of Panola County, Texas.

Each row below records one filing or status update. Only the fields that changed from the prior record are shown; unchanged values are inherited from the row below. The oldest row (first known record) shows the initial state.

Note on permit dates: for TX this column reflects the completion permit on file (W-2 / G-1), not the original drilling permit (W-1). A re-completion later in the well’s life creates a new permit_date entry, which is why a permit can date after the spud.
